LQCTT-150kV Cable Test Termination System

Professional-grade cable testing solution designed for 150kV high-voltage cable testing with precision partial discharge measurement and integrated cooling system.

Key Electrical Specifications

  • Rated Voltage: 150kV RMS

  • Partial Discharge Level: <1pC at Un

  • Impulse Voltage Rating: 550kV (Negative polarity)

  • Power Supply: 220V/20A, 50/60Hz

  • Max. Cable Dimension: 133mm (including insulation)

Cooling System Specifications

ParameterSpecification
Max. Cooling Capacity60kW
Water Capacity500 liters
Max. Operating Temperature60°C
Max. Pressure4 atm
Water Conductivity Range0.1-2 μS/cm
Min. Flow Velocity45 l/min
Connecting Pipe1 inch
Water Pipe Head3/4 inch

Environmental Specifications

  • Ambient Temperature Range: 3°C to 35°C

  • Max. Cooling Water Temperature: 20°C

  • Min. HV Insulation Distance: 1000mm

Physical Dimensions & Configuration

  • Main Unit Dimensions: 1200×1400×1700mm (L×W×H)

  • Base Dimensions: 1800×1200mm (L×W)

  • Terminal Weight: 250kg (for two sets)

  • System Weight: 272kg (without water)

  • Terminal Tilt Angle: 30°

  • Cable Mounting Height: 1000mm

  • Terminal Mounting Height: 1900mm

Testing Capabilities

  • Partial Discharge Testing: <1pC sensitivity

  • Impulse Voltage Testing: Up to 550kV negative polarity

  • HV Withstand Testing: Continuous 150kV operation

  • Thermal Performance Testing: 60°C temperature validation

  • Pressure Testing: Up to 4 atm pressure conditions

Operation & Safety Features

  • Automatic Cooling Control: Maintains optimal temperature during tests

  • Water Quality Monitoring: Continuous conductivity measurement

  • Pressure Safety Release: Automatic venting at 4.2 atm

  • Thermal Overload Protection: Shutdown at 65°C

  • Insulation Monitoring: Ensures minimum 1000mm clearance

Installation Requirements

ParameterRequirement
FoundationLevel concrete floor ≥200mm thickness
ClearancesFront: 2000mm, Sides: 1500mm
Water Supply45 l/min minimum flow rate
Power Connection220V±10%, 20A dedicated circuit
Grounding≤5Ω earth resistance

Maintenance Protocol

  1. Daily:

    • Check water conductivity levels

    • Verify cooling system flow rate

  2. Weekly:

    • Inspect termination interfaces for damage

    • Test safety interlocks

  3. Monthly:

    • Calibrate partial discharge sensors

    • Perform dielectric fluid quality check

  4. Annual:

    • Full HV system calibration

    • Pressure vessel certification

    • Cooling system comprehensive service

Compliance Standards

  • IEC 60270: Partial discharge measurements

  • IEC 60885-3: Electrical test methods for electric cables

  • IEEE 400: Guide for field testing of shielded power cable systems

  • IEC 60502: Power cables with extruded insulation

  • ISO 9001: Quality management systems
